The North Cascades in Washington state form the largest and most rugged alpine wilderness mountain range in the contiguous United States. At a time when most American guides provided no instruction to their clients, the founders launched a mountaineering school offering courses in ice climbing, rock climbing, glacier skills, and off-piste skiing, with a mission to grow their clients into self-sufficient climbers. The bulk of the climbing is found in the two canyons west of the town of Leavenworth in Icicle Creek and Tumwater Canyon. These weather-resistant rocks have been heavily sculpted by alpine glaciation, producing stunning peaks and ridges. We just ad Leavenworth – Perhaps the densest climbing area in Washington State, with a wide range of sport and traditional climbing from single pitches to over 800ft tall cliffs. August 1 – 6 A note about traditional mountaineering in North Cascades National Park Service Complex: Almost all of the mountaineering objectives lie in the Stephen Mather Wilderness which was designated in 1988.
